Packages

Packages

Packages allow you to sell credits for your other services (rentals, lessons, or classes) at discounted rates.

You can visit the Packages page by navigating to Services > Packages (opens in a new tab) in the Swift Admin Dashboard.

When to Use Packages

Packages are a great way to pass on a discount to your customers, while benefiting directly from a larger upfront revenue. You can use packages to provide your customers with a certain number of services for a discounted rate that has to be paid up front.

For example, 8 Hitting Lessons for $300, or a Winter Camp Package are a few ways you can increase cash flow immediately, while still also providing value for your customers.

Create a New Package

In order to create a package, you need:

  • A name & description
  • A price
  • Credits

Pricing

In this section, you can decide exactly how much you want to charge customers for buying this package.

To add a price, click "Add price". Immediately, you'll be presented with the options to configure a price. This includes:

Price Value

The raw dollar amount that you want to charge for the package (ex: $200)

Applies To Membership Groups

This is the most important piece to any price. It controls which groups of customers can see & pay this price

By default, any price that is not assigned to a group of customers will not be visible by people in that group.

For example, if you'd like the public to pay $120 for a package, you would:

  • Set the price to $120
  • Add the "Public (Non Members)" group to this "Applies to Membership Groups" dropdown
Membership Discounts

How would you give members a discount (or free) access to this package? By creating another price!

Click "Add another price", and:

  • Set the price to $50 (or the discounted price of your choice - it can also be free)
  • Add the specific membership group in the "Applies to Membership Groups" dropdown. Make sure the "Public (Non Members)" group is not present here.

This concept is so important, that it's worth stating twice.

Customers will only have access to prices and services that you've configured here. If the Public (Non Members) group does not have a price for this package, they will not be able to buy it.

You can create as many prices as you'd like, as long as they are unique (target different membership groups). For a deeper breakdown on how prices work, visit the Services Pricing section.

Credits

Credits can be redeemed to pay for services. Each credit represents a unit of a service.

For example, 1 credit for a rental with a minimum duration of 30 minutes means that the credit can be used for the specified rental for a 30 min session to get a 100% discount. If a 1 hour session is being purchased, the credit will discount 50% of the price.

Credits that apply to lessons and classes don't have the concept of minimum duration, and will apply to any 1 unit of the service. So for example, 5 credits for a class can be used to purchase 5 sessions of that class at a 100% discount. When creating credits, you can optionally specify:

  • Expiry: You can set an explicit expiry date in the future, or automatically make the credits expire after a certain period of time after the purchase
  • Usage restrictions: This is abuse protection, and you can set limits on how often credits can be used

Edit A Package

To edit a package, click into the specific package from the Services > Packages (opens in a new tab) page and you will be taken to the "Edit Package" form.

Here, you can edit any of the details mentioned above. Just remember to click "Save" at the bottom to apply your changes!

Duplicate An Existing Package

To make it easier to create multiple packages, you can click into an existing package on the Services > Packages (opens in a new tab) page, and then click the "bottom arrow" icon on the top right, beside the "Copy direct booking link" button.

You'll now be navigated to a new "Add Package" form, with all the details of the previous package filled in! The title will have the word "(Copy)" added to it, to indicate that this is a duplicated package.

Delete A Package

To delete a package, click into an existing package and scroll down to the bottom of the page. There, you'll see a "Delete" button on the bottom left.

This button may be disabled if customers have already started buying this package. It may also be disabled if you don't have the permission to delete it (in which case, you should talk to the owner or someone with more access).

If the package can be deleted, you can click Delete and hit "Confirm" on the modal that appears to remove this package. Remember, this action cannot be undone.

Miscellaneous

There are some additional things you can do with packages, which are explained below.

Tax Rates

Enable the "Collect tax" toggle to charge customers a pre-defined tax rate when they purchase this package. This will populate the correct tax amount on your booking page, as well as internally on the admin side of Swift when you charge customers.

collecting-tax

If you don't have any tax rates created, visit the Tax Rates settings section to learn how to add them.

Making a Private Package

Under "Advanced Settings", you can turn on the "Private" toggle to "On" to make a package private.

By doing this, only customers with a direct booking link to this package will be able to book it. It will be invisible to all other customers, and will not appear on your booking page.

Direct Booking Links

Want to send a direct link to book a package to a customer? Perhaps you have a private package that only specific customers can book? Or you would like to add a button on your website that takes customers directly to this package?

This button does exactly that! On the top right of a package form, you should see the "Copy direct booking link" button. Click this, and a direct link to the package will be copied to your clipboard.

Booking Page Appearance

You may also want to control how the "Packages" category as a whole appears on the booking page. You may want to call it "Credit Bundles" instead of the generic "Packages" shown on Swift. In that case, you can visit the Services > Packages (opens in a new tab) page in your admin dashboard, and click the "gear" icon on the top right.

You will now see a modal pop up, with a few options. Here, you can customize:

  • The title of the Packages category - you can call it "Credit Bundles" for example
  • The description of the Packages category - you can add any additional context here

Once you hit Save, both of these changes will be immediately reflected on your booking page.